Changing Paradigm of Software Development – Proprietary to Open Source Model

During the beyond 30 years the arena went through a completely dynamic technological transformation. In retrospective, it is able to be said without exaggeration that the emergence of digital devices and the Internet have substantially impacted day by day existence as well as managerial exercise to an unforeseen extent. The computerization of more than one commercial enterprise tactics and the introduction of massive scale databases, amongst many other radical technological advances, have lead to huge fee financial savings and quality enhancements over time. The interconnection of economic markets via electronic manner and the global adoption of the Internet have significantly reduced transaction and communication charges and brought international locations and cultures in the direction of each other than ever conceivable. Computers are now fundamental tools in almost all agencies round the arena and their application and edition to precise enterprise troubles in the shape of software program development is a practice that many companies carry out on their personal. In the beyond, such computerization and automation efforts had been very pricey and consequently handiest practiced by way of large corporations. Over the years, however, the software enterprise emerged to provide off-the-shelf answers and offerings to smaller organizations. Today, having survived the big dotcom crash of the yr 2000, software improvement organizations hooked up themselves as strong players inside the era enterprise.

The emergence of severa pc standards and technologies has Hardware created many demanding situations and possibilities. One of the main possibilities supplied by using the software program area is fairly low entry barrier. Since the software program business isn’t always capital intensive, successful marketplace access largely relies upon on expertise and particular industry domain information. Entrepreneurs with the proper abilties can notably without problems compete with huge agencies and thereby pose a tremendous threat to other, a whole lot larger corporations. Companies, on the other hand, want to find ways to reduce turnover and guard their intellectual property; therefore, the sturdy information dependence combined with the noticeably quick lifespan of computer technology makes expertise employees very crucial to the organisation. Knowledge employees on this industry therefore revel in stronger bargaining power and require a exclusive management fashion and work surroundings than in other sectors, especially the ones industries which have higher marketplace entry capital necessities. This pretty strong position of software personnel challenges human useful resource strategies in agencies and it additionally increases worries about the protection of intellectual property.

The enormously younger industry is blessed with sheer infinite new possibilities, consisting of the capability of organizations to cooperate with different corporations around the world without interruption and incur almost no conversation fees. In addition, no import price lists exist making the switch of software program throughout borders very green; however, the industry with its craft-like professions suffers from loss of requirements and exceptional issues. The a success management of such dynamic groups challenges modern managers as well as cutting-edge management technology due to the fact conventional control patterns, along with Weberian bureaucracies, seem to be not able to address risky environments.